Brimfield – William G. Bessette, Jr., 60 passed away peacefully Saturday, September 9, 2023.

A loud voice with a commanding presence and an enormous heart.  Billy was a strong, hardworking, and gracious man, a steadfast, devoted Dad and a dedicated, dependable employee. Billy loved deeply and appreciated life’s simplest joys. He attended Pathfinder Regional Technical High School where he focused his studies on auto body repair. Billy’s greatest passion was classic cars and bringing them back to their original glory, or chopping and molding them into “hotrods”– all works of art.  A garage was Billy’s happy place, tinkering on cars, trucks, motorcycles – anything with wheels or a motor, he enjoyed a break and a cold drink when friends would happen by, with classic country or golden oldies playing as a backdrop, inspiring his work.

A NASCAR fan for life, rarely was a race missed except for very special life moments. Billy loved rocking chairs, “good” junk shops, swap meets, drive in movies, singing, road trips, back roads, canoe trips, and treasured time spent at “Camp” in New Hampshire, making memories was important. He loved the Quabbin Reservoir, picnics, flying kites, his lawn, wildflowers and roses, flying an American flag proudly, most recently learning fly fishing, baking muffins, making Saturday morning breakfast, preparing Sunday afternoon junk food for a race and serving it up with “blue” juice boxes, he loved ice cream and always enjoying dessert…. first.  Billy was enthusiastic and took great pride in having been the biggest fan; and mostly, one-man pit crew for the boys and their race bikes.  “Just Billy” became a self-given and later revered title.  Billy was beloved by his large and loving family, and an unmeasurable lifetime of friends of all ages, including his four-legged, loyal Rosie.

Billy leaves his longtime sweetheart and partner in life, Mona Rand; his son, Jason Bessette and his wife Danielle of Palmer, and his son, Justin Bessette of Westfield, Mona’s children, Rebecca Wurster (Michael), Jesse Gibbs (Erica), Timothy Rand (Veronica), Amber Rand (Darren Barrington), Gabriel Rand (Erica), his cherished mother, Betty Ann (Racine) Webber, brother Shawn Webber (Carolyn), sisters Barbara Bessette and Erica Webber, fourteen precious grandchildren with one on the way, as well as three nieces and a nephew, many aunts, uncles and cousins. He loved and will be sadly missed by “Gram” Gibbs, his best friend “Wes” Gates and his step grandfather Ike Bryant.

Billy was predeceased by his father William G. Bessette, Sr. and Stepdad, David Webber. And an adored man’s best friend “Poop” Dog.

Billy was born in Vernon, CT and went on to settle in Wales and Brimfield, MA.  Billy had been employed by T.J. O’Keefe Construction, as well as many years working with the Fortier family, more recently with Collins & Sons Construction, all of Wales, MA.  Billy attended New Birth Christian Church in Thorndike, where he will be missed by his amazing, supportive church family.

Services and a celebration of life will take place Saturday, September 30th at New Birth Christian Church, 4025 Church Street, Thorndike, MA. Family will receive visitation from 10:00 a.m. – 2:00 p.m. with a memorial service taking place at 12:00 noon.
